The genus Tillandsia (Bromeliaceae) in the department of Lambayeque, Peru

There are 26 taxa of Tillandsia (Bromeliaceae) that occur in the department of Lambayeque, Peru, of which 12 are registered for the first time, occupying different ecoregions and plant formations, from the low tillandsial to the Jalca. Dichotomous keys for the determination of subgenera, species and varieties are presented and updated data on geographical distribution, altitudinal range, uses and conservation are also provided.
